Trauma and Post-Traumatic Stress:

For individuals who have experienced real-life abductions or trauma, kidnapping dreams can be a manifestation of post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). Exploring these dreams from a psychological perspective can provide insights into the lingering effects of trauma and facilitate the healing process through therapeutic interventions.

Can lucid dreaming be used to change the outcome of a dream about being kidnapped?

Lucid dreaming, the state of being aware that you are dreaming while in the dream, can provide an opportunity to consciously influence the course of your dream, including dreams about being kidnapped. By developing lucid dreaming techniques, such as reality checks and maintaining dream awareness, it may be possible to alter the outcome of the dream and gain a sense of control over the situation.

What do dreams of being kidnapped mean?

Dreams of being kidnapped can have different meanings depending on the context and personal experiences of the dreamer. Generally, being kidnapped in a dream may symbolize a feeling of being trapped, controlled, or overwhelmed in waking life. It could suggest a lack of control over a situation or a fear of losing power. Alternatively, it might reflect a desire for freedom and escape from responsibilities or constraints.
